Microsoft has identified some users who are having driver related issues when trying to sync this is generally resolved by reinstalling windows mobile device center again.

It is important that you install WMDC before connecting your device to your PC. However if you have already connected your device and received the Driver failed to install error message, you can resolve the issue by removing the devices generic RNDIS driver entry from Device Manager.

Disconnect your device for your PC

From the start Menu open the control panel

Select "Hardware and Sound" then "Device Manager"

Now connect your device to you PC so that the associated driver shows up under "Network adapter"

Right click on the driver and select Uninstall

At this point disconnect your device, install WMDC if you haven't already done so and the reconnect your device. WMDC should recognize the device and complete the driver install.
